Commit 3d86ee17 authored by Eugen Hristev's avatar Eugen Hristev Committed by Stephen Boyd
Browse files

dt-bindings: clock: at91: add sama7g5 pll defines



Add SAMA7G5 specific PLL defines to be referenced in a phandle as a
PMC_TYPE_CORE clock.

Suggested-by: default avatarClaudiu Beznea <claudiu.beznea@microchip.com>
Signed-off-by: default avatarEugen Hristev <eugen.hristev@microchip.com>
[claudiu.beznea@microchip.com: adapt comit message, adapt sama7g5.c]
Signed-off-by: default avatarClaudiu Beznea <claudiu.beznea@microchip.com>
Link: https://lore.kernel.org/r/1605800597-16720-3-git-send-email-claudiu.beznea@microchip.com


Signed-off-by: default avatarStephen Boyd <sboyd@kernel.org>
parent 91274497
Loading
Loading
Loading
Loading
+3 −3
Original line number Diff line number Diff line
@@ -182,13 +182,13 @@ static const struct {
		  .p = "audiopll_fracck",
		  .l = &pll_layout_divpmc,
		  .t = PLL_TYPE_DIV,
		  .eid = PMC_I2S0_MUX, },
		  .eid = PMC_AUDIOPMCPLL, },

		{ .n = "audiopll_diviock",
		  .p = "audiopll_fracck",
		  .l = &pll_layout_divio,
		  .t = PLL_TYPE_DIV,
		  .eid = PMC_I2S1_MUX, },
		  .eid = PMC_AUDIOIOPLL, },
	},

	[PLL_ID_ETH] = {
@@ -835,7 +835,7 @@ static void __init sama7g5_pmc_setup(struct device_node *np)
	if (IS_ERR(regmap))
		return;

	sama7g5_pmc = pmc_data_allocate(PMC_I2S1_MUX + 1,
	sama7g5_pmc = pmc_data_allocate(PMC_ETHPLL + 1,
					nck(sama7g5_systemck),
					nck(sama7g5_periphck),
					nck(sama7g5_gck), 8);
+10 −0
Original line number Diff line number Diff line
@@ -25,6 +25,16 @@
#define PMC_PLLBCK		8
#define PMC_AUDIOPLLCK		9

/* SAMA7G5 */
#define PMC_CPUPLL		(PMC_MAIN + 1)
#define PMC_SYSPLL		(PMC_MAIN + 2)
#define PMC_DDRPLL		(PMC_MAIN + 3)
#define PMC_IMGPLL		(PMC_MAIN + 4)
#define PMC_BAUDPLL		(PMC_MAIN + 5)
#define PMC_AUDIOPMCPLL		(PMC_MAIN + 6)
#define PMC_AUDIOIOPLL		(PMC_MAIN + 7)
#define PMC_ETHPLL		(PMC_MAIN + 8)

#ifndef AT91_PMC_MOSCS
#define AT91_PMC_MOSCS		0		/* MOSCS Flag */
#define AT91_PMC_LOCKA		1		/* PLLA Lock */